How to watch Michigan State vs Oregon
The Oregon Ducks are currently the No. 6-ranked college football team in the country. They're high up the AP Poll Rankings largely thanks to their 4-0 record to start the season. The Michigan State Spartans will be looking to end their rival's unbeaten record.
Here's what you need to know about how to watch the game:
Date: Friday, Oct. 4, 2024
Live stream: FuboTV and DAZN
Time: 9:00 p.m. ET
TV: FOX
Venue: Autzen Stadium, Eugene, Oregon
Ad
The Oregon Ducks were phenomenal against the UCLA Bruins, and quarterback Dillon Gabriel completed three touchdown passes for the powerhouse program. The Ducks added 153 rushing yards for good measure.
Furthermore, Jordan James had a stellar showing at running back, rushing for 103 yards and scoring a touchdown in the process. That means that James now has 386 rushing yards and four touchdowns in 2024.
The Michigan State Spartans have struggled to generate elite offense in recent games. They've scored just two touchdowns in the past two games. It's not going to be any easier against a defensively aware Oregon Ducks side with national championship aspirations.
